> Ah. I see the problem. When I said
>
> >> If all you want to do is copy+paste text, then just highlight it
> >> with your mouse, go to the window where you want to paste,
> >> and click the middle mouse button.
>
> I didn't mention any such command because there isn't any. Just
> highlighting text will "copy" it; clicking the middle mouse button will
> "paste" whatever was most recently highlighted.
